Questions parents ask about Parker Landing Child Development Center

How many infants and toddlers can Parker Landing Child Development Center take?

Colorado licenses Parker Landing Child Development Center for 18 infants and 42 toddlers. These are the bands the state publishes separately and they do not add up to the licence total, so treat each as its own ceiling. A licensed place is not the same as an open place, so ask about current availability.

Who can help me find child care near Parker Landing Child Development Center?

Parker Landing Child Development Center sits in the area covered by the Douglas County Early Childhood Council and the referral agency Child Care Innovations. Colorado funds these bodies to help families find and pay for care locally, and they can answer questions about openings and cost that a licence record cannot.

Does Parker Landing Child Development Center accept CCCAP child care assistance?

The state record does not show Parker Landing Child Development Center authorised for the Colorado Child Care Assistance Program. Authorisation is county-administered and can change, so confirm with the provider and your county office.
